Arizona College Prep was not able to break out of their rough patch on Tuesday as the team picked up their eighth straight loss. They lost 71-45 to the Notre Dame Prep Saints. Unfortunately, that's the second time they've come up short against the Saints this season, as they also lost their prior matchup 62-38 back in December of 2024.
Arizona College Prep's defeat came despite a true team effort with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Justice Moore, who posted eight points and five rebounds. Another player making a difference was Arman Bhakta, who put up seven points.
Arizona College Prep's loss dropped their record down to 6-16. As for Notre Dame Prep, the win (which was their eighth in a row) raised their record to 19-3.
Arizona College Prep wasted no time getting back out on the court and has already played their next game, a 61-57 defeat against Chaparral on the 7th. As for Notre Dame Prep, they also did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next matchup, a 66-34 victory against Desert Mountain on the 7th.
